Obituary:
Richard James Phillips, DDS, affectionately know as “Pop” was born in Healdsburg CA on August 16, 1918 to Walter and Nina (Brown) Phillips. He passed away on March 15, 2012 at home in Visalia CA. He attended High School in La Crescenta CA. Richard was a decorated Captain in the United States Army, serving in WWII stateside and in the South Pacific. He received his degree at Stanford University and then attended dental school at USC in Southern California. Richard lived many years in San Fernando Valley where his practice was. He also lived in Westlake Village and Hemet before moving to Exeter in 2003. Richard was a talented carver, a member of the Carvers Club and won many awards and amazed many family member and friends with beautifully carved gifts. He also was a member of the Lazy Daze motorhome club and he and his wife Joyce traveled extensively. Richard and Joyce were members of Exeter Methodist Church. He also attended other local churches with his son and daughter in law including Rocky Hill Community Church where the service will be held.
Richard retired at the age of 65 after being a dentist in the city of Woodland Hills of over 40 years. (He started practice and 10 years later his older brother Walt Phillips joined him as a partner.) His wife Joyce was his assistant. He trained her, and then, when he married her on December 8, 1973 in Las Vegas NV, he fired her.
